How To Design A Business Card


How to design a business card you ask? It's very simple! Most standard business card designs are 2" x 3.5" inches in size. Business card designs can have many different shapes, sizes and coating options. Most printers will print your designed business card with a bleed. A bleed is a .125" inch addition that needs to be added onto the hight and width of the business card design. The reason for the bleed is so when the printers print the business cards, none of your design gets cut off. So how exactly do you design a business card...? Follow the steps below to learn more.
